Description:


Situated in the popular suburb of Thorpe St Andrew is this simply stunning and modernised, extended, three bedroom end terrace with accommodation comprising lounge, dining room, modern fitted kitchen and large bathroom to the ground floor. On the first floor there are three good size bedrooms off- landing. Outside there is a small, low maintenance front garden and to the rear there is a well presented garden ideal for entertaining and single brick built garage. The house benefits from double glazing, gas central heating with the ground floor having underfloor heating and is in superb condition throughout. Internal viewing is highly recommended to appreciate the quality on offer.
Location

Yarmouth Road is situated close by too many local amenities including schooling, popular local shops, pubs, restaurants, butchers and supermarkets and has great access to and from the city centre. You also close by to Norwich train station, the A47 southern bypass and Broadland Business Park.
